What You'll Do
• Provide individualized ABA therapy in homes or centers.
• Follow treatment plans designed by a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A).
• Collect data, track progress, and collaborate with families and supervisors.
What We're Looking For
• Passion for working with children (experience in teaching, childcare, coaching, tutoring, or caregiving is a plus).
• High school diploma or equivalent (college preferred).
• Driver's license, car insurance, and weekday afternoon/evening availability.
• Able to pass background check; CPR/First Aid required (we'll help you get certified).
What We Offer
• $21/hour during training; $25-$28/hour after, based on experience and/or RBT status.
• Paid training and support to earn your Registered Behavior Technician (RBT) certification.
• Ongoing professional development and career advancement opportunities.
• A collaborative, supportive team culture.
